The City of Martinez, in conjunction with the County Office of Emergency Services, is sponsoring Emergency Preparedness classes for residents of the community.
The goals of the CERT program are to enable neighborhood or workplace teams to prepare for and respond effectively to an event until professional responders arrive, to provide a link between neighborhood or workplace teams and professional responders, and to integrate CERT Zones into the community. CERT members are then integrated into the emergency response capability for their area.
CERT training will include 20 hours of instruction over a 6 week period in the following areas:
- Disaster Preparedness and Terrorism
- Fire Safety
- Disaster Medical Operations
- Light Search and Rescue
- CERT Organization and Disaster Psychology
- Final Simulated Disaster Exercise
